Video compression using block vector predictor refinement

1. A method comprising:
determining, by a computing device and based on an intra block copy (IBC) reference region comprising positions of a plurality of valid reference blocks, one or more candidate block vector predictors (BVPs), wherein each of the one or more candidate BVPs comprises at least one of:
a horizontal component determined based on a width of a current block, or
a vertical component determined based on a height of the current block; and
determining a block vector (BV) for the current block based on a list of candidate BVPs that is modified to include at least one candidate BVP, from among the one or more candidate BVPs, that indicates a displacement from the current block to a position in the IBC reference region.
